Ruling party
candidate Vice President Dr Mahamudu Bawumia don concede defeat to former
President John Mahama.
Dis na even
though di electoral commission neva announce result.
Vice
President Bawumia for news conference dis morning say im decision na based on
provisional results collated.
Ghana hold
general elections yesterday to elect a new president and members of parliament.

Communications minister Ursula Owusu lose Ablekuma West constituency
Wia dis foto come from, Ursula Owusu-Ekuful/Facebook
Wetin we call dis foto, Ghana Communications Ursula Owusu-Ekuful
One ogbonge
minister of state Ursula Owusu-Ekuful don lose di Ablekuma west parliamentary
seat for di Greater Accra region.
Di minister
loose to di NDC candidate Reverend Kweku Addo afta im dey parliament since
2012.
For di
goment party NPP, Ursula na one of di leading members wia im serve as minister
of communications for eight years.
Result wey
di EC returning officer announce na;
Ursula
Owusu-Ekuful (NPP) - 26,575
Reverend
Kweku Addo (NDC) - 31866
Rejected -
351
Total voter
population - 99465
Total valid
votes - 58441
Independent candidate win for NPP stronghold for Ashanti region
Wia dis foto come from, Ohene Kwame Frimpong/Facebook
Wetin we call dis foto, Ohene Kwame Frimpong, independent candidate
One
independent candidate wia be businessman don win di Asante Akim North seat for
di Ashanti region.
Ohene Kwame
Frimpong win di vote wit ova 18,000 votes.
For many
sabi pipo, dis gap don dey shocking as many bin tink say di sitting MP Andy
Appiah Kubi go retain di seat.
Di result
wey di EC returning officer announce na;
Andy Appiah
Kubi (NPP) - 8,933
Ohene Kwame
Frimpong (independent) - 26,926
Kofi Asamoah (NDC) - 2,469
Total valid - 38,328
Total
rejected ballot - 513
Total vote
cast : 38,841
Tourism minister lose for Sekondi constituency - Western Region
Wia dis foto come from, Andrew Egyapa Mercer/Facebook
Wetin we call dis foto, NPP MP and tourism minister Andrew Egyapa Mercer
Tourism
minister Andrew Egyapa Mercer wey bifor na deputy energy minister don lose im
parliamentary seat.
Andrew na
ogbonge member of di goment party di NPP, wia im lose im seat to di NDC
candidate.
Lawyer
Mercer na MP for dis constituency since 2016.
Hia na
result wey di retuning officer declare;
Andrew
Egyapa Mercer (NPP) - 11,084
Blay Nyameke
Armah (NDC) - 14, 558
Rejected
ballot - 176
Total valid
votes - 25,642
Total votes
cast - 25,818
Di MP-elect
Blay Nyameke Armah of di NDC tok say im tank im constituents wey im tok say
“dis win na win for di whole constituency and we go rebuild and reset sekondi
togeda.”
Electoral commission overview afta close of voting
Di electoral
commission confam say as at 5pm on 7 December, 95% of polling stations across
di kontri don close polls.
Oga Bannor
Bio wey be director of electoral service tok say “only a few polling stations
continue to vote afta 5 pm sake of dem no start early wia some places bin get
some wahala.”
Di EC also
say dia early report bin show say dia biometric verification devices bin work
smoothly across di ova 40,000 polling stations across di kontri.
“Also voting
don happun fast dis year as each pesin neva spend more than 3 minutes to vote.
Dis be sake of how we divide some of di polling stations wia each voting center
get only 750 voters, to avoid crowd and long queues,” oga Bannor Bio explain.
Lights go off for at least two constituencies during collation
As counting
of ballots and collation bin dey happun late into di night, some chaos don dey
happun.
For di
Ayawaso north and Madina constituencies, light bin go off wey cause some tension
among di supporters of di candidates wia dey dis centres for Accra.
Dis power
outage bin affect di process for sometime bifor dem later kontinu.
Director of
electoral services for di electoral commission confam during dia press
conference say dem dey fix di mata
“Di EC bin
engage di electricity company of Ghana to restore power to dis two collation
centres. We get hope say dem go restore di light as soon as possible,” oga
Bannor Bio tok.
Chaos for some constituency polling stations
For di Western
region of di kontri, police bin arrest one pesin say im engage for double
voting in di Wassa Akropong-Appiahkrom polling station.
Dis pesin na
polling station agent - police say im dey dia custody to dey assist di police for
dis investigation.
For di
Okaikwei south constituency for Accra, di police arrest one pesin wey don dey
hold weapon for di St Theresa school polling station
In di Bono
East region of di kontri, police don gbab one electoral commission official.
Interior minister Henry Quartey lose im seat as MP for Ayawaso Central constituency
Wia dis foto come from, Photos: Ministry of Interior/Facebook
Wetin we call dis foto, Interior minister, NPP MP Henry Quartey
Henry
Quartey na ogbonge pesin for di goment party. Bifor di president select am as
interior minister, im be di greater Accra regional minister
Im lose di
election to di NDC candidate Abdul Rauf Tubazu.
Result wey Ghana
EC Gladstone Agboada announce na;
Henry
Quartey (NPP) - 23,345
Abdul Rauf
Tubazu (NDC) - 29,755
Charles
Kwame Adams (NDP) - 163
Rejected
ballot - 287
Total votes
cast - 53,550
Afta dem
declare am winner, Abdul Rauf tok say im bin dey confident since, say im go
win.
“Dis win don
sweet sake of all di executives of di party don try well well wia we achieve
dis result. We go work for di pipo.”

Police arrest four suspects for shooting incident
Wia dis foto come from, Ghana police
Di Ghana police say dem arrest four pipo ova one shooting incident for di Awuku Senya East constituency for di central region wey lead to di death of one pesin wit anoda one injured.
Di suspects dey dia custody while investigation kontinu.
Di pesin wey don hurt bin dey receive treatment for hospital wia dem carry di body of pesin wey die to morgue for autopsy
